当前位置: 首页 > news >正文

贵阳营销型网站建设四川有那些网站建设公司

贵阳营销型网站建设,四川有那些网站建设公司,网站建设的技术准备,百度竞价网站源码什么是响应式设计 响应式就是同一个代码可以自动适应不同设备和屏幕尺寸#xff0c;以提供最佳的用户体验。响应式设计的目标是确保网站在不同设备上呈现内容和布局时能够自动调整#xff0c;以适应屏幕的大小和方向。这意味着网站可以在台式电脑、平板电脑、手机和其他各种…什么是响应式设计 响应式就是同一个代码可以自动适应不同设备和屏幕尺寸以提供最佳的用户体验。响应式设计的目标是确保网站在不同设备上呈现内容和布局时能够自动调整以适应屏幕的大小和方向。这意味着网站可以在台式电脑、平板电脑、手机和其他各种设备上有效显示而不需要为每种设备创建不同版本的网站。响应式设计使用 HTML、CSS 和 JavaScript 技术来实现以确保网站内容能够根据访问设备的特征进行动态调整。 最常见的标签导航在不同的屏幕下做适当的调整 响应式网站具有以下特点 自适应布局网站的布局会根据设备的屏幕尺寸和方向自动调整以确保内容合理分布和可读性。 弹性图像和媒体图像和媒体元素会根据屏幕大小和分辨率进行优化以提供更快的加载速度和更好的视觉效果。 可变字体大小文本内容的字体大小会根据屏幕尺寸进行调整以确保文本在不同设备上易于阅读。 导航调整导航菜单和链接会根据屏幕大小进行调整可能以折叠或滑动方式显示以节省空间。 内容的显示和隐藏某些内容可能会在小屏幕上被隐藏或折叠以减少页面复杂性而在大屏幕上则显示。 触摸和手势支持响应式设计通常包括对触摸屏设备的支持以确保网站在移动设备上有良好的交互性。 如何实现 实现原理就是通过媒体检测不同的设备的屏幕尺寸根据不同的尺寸做不同的样式。实现响应式设计的方式主要包括弹性布局、媒体查询、相对单位、流体图像、流体网格系统等。 meta nameviewport contentwidthdevice-width, initial-scale1, maximum-scale1, user-scalableno”name“viewport”指定了这是一个关于视口设置的标签。 content包含了一系列视口设置参数它们的作用如下 widthdevice-width使网页的视口宽度等于设备的屏幕宽度。这确保了网页内容可以根据设备的屏幕尺寸进行自适应。 initial-scale1设置初始缩放级别为 1即不进行初始缩放。这有助于确保网页在加载时以原始大小显示。 maximum-scale1限制了用户缩放的最大级别为 1防止用户放大页面。这有助于保持页面的布局和响应性。 user-scalableno禁用了用户对页面进行缩放的能力。这意味着用户无法手动放大或缩小页面。 媒体查询: 媒体查询是一种CSS功能用于根据不同的设备和屏幕尺寸应用不同的样式规则。以下是一个简单的示例 /* 默认样式 */ body {font-size: 16px;background-color: #f0f0f0; }/* 在小屏幕上应用的样式 */ media (max-width: 1366px) {body {font-size: 14px;background-color: #e0e0e0;} } /* 视口在 375到736之间时*/ media screen and (min-width: 375px) and (max-width: 736px){ .... }通过媒体查询可以实现不同分辨率下的不同样式。 相对单位: 使用相对单位如百分比、em、rem可以实现元素的自适应。以下是一个使用百分比的简单示例 .container {width: 80%;margin: 0 auto; }.button {font-size: 1.5em;padding: 1em 2em; }注意 在百分比中height和width的值是依赖父元素的宽高的确保父元素的尺寸是已知的否则百分比可能不会按预期工作。 top、bottom、right 和 left 属性可以接受百分比值作为其值用于指定元素的定位或边距。这些百分比值是相对于元素的包含块通常是其父元素的相应边缘来计算的。 margin、padding的百分比无论方向都是相对父元素的宽度取值。vw、vh 它们分别表示视口宽度viewport width和视口高度viewport height。这些单位是相对于浏览器窗口的尺寸来计算的。em 和 rem 都是用于设置字体大小和布局的相对长度单位但它们在某些方面有不同的工作方式 em字母“m”em 是相对于元素自身字体大小的单位。例如如果一个元素的字体大小为 16px设置 2em 的 font-size 将使该元素的字体大小变为 32px。此外em 单位还可以应用于其他属性如 margin、padding、width 等。如果应用嵌套元素em 单位将相对于其最近的具有字体大小定义的祖先元素。 rem字母“r”和“m”的组合rem 是相对于根元素通常是 html 元素的字体大小的单位。它的值不会受到嵌套元素的字体大小的影响。如果根元素的字体大小为 16px设置 2rem 的 font-size 将使字体大小为 32px无论元素位于文档的任何位置。 流体图像: 流体图像可以根据屏幕大小进行自适应。以下是使用img元素的srcset属性和picture元素的示例 picturesource srcsetlarge-image.jpg media(min-width: 768px)source srcsetmedium-image.jpg media(min-width: 480px)img srcsmall-image.jpg altResponsive Image /picture在这个示例中根据屏幕宽度浏览器会选择加载适当分辨率的图像。 流体网格系统: 使用流体网格系统如CSS Flexbox和CSS Grid可以创建灵活的页面布局。以下是一个使用Flexbox的简单示例 .container {display: flex;flex-wrap: wrap; }.item {flex: 1;margin: 10px; }在这个示例中.container内的.item元素会自动排列成一行如果空间不足它们会自动折行。 如何监听视口变化 resize 事件resize 事件会在浏览器窗口的大小发生变化时触发。你可以使用它来执行与响应式设计相关的操作例如调整页面布局或重新计算元素的尺寸。 window.addEventListener(resize, function() {// 处理窗口大小变化的代码 });orientationchange 事件orientationchange 事件会在设备方向变化横屏/竖屏切换时触发。这对于移动设备非常有用。 window.addEventListener(orientationchange, function() {// 处理设备方向变化的代码 });总结 响应式设计是一种用于创建适应不同设备和屏幕尺寸的网页和应用程序的设计方法。它具有许多优点但也存在一些潜在的缺点。下面是响应式设计的优点和缺点的总结 优点 适应多种设备和屏幕尺寸响应式设计使网站和应用程序能够在不同设备上提供一致的用户体验包括电脑、平板、手机等。 维护简单相对于为每个设备和屏幕尺寸创建单独的版本响应式设计减少了开发和维护的工作量因为你只需要维护一个代码库。 更好的SEO响应式设计有助于提高搜索引擎优化SEO因为网站内容的一致性可以提高搜索引擎排名。 改进用户体验响应式设计可以提供更好的用户体验因为它允许内容适应不同屏幕尺寸无需用户手动缩放。 节省成本相对于为每个设备构建独立的应用响应式设计可以节省开发和维护成本。 支持未来设备随着新设备和屏幕尺寸的出现响应式设计可以更轻松地适应未来的技术。 缺点 性能问题响应式设计可能导致性能问题因为在加载时可能需要下载不必要的资源这可能影响页面加载速度。 复杂性创建复杂的响应式布局可能需要更多的HTML和CSS代码可能增加开发的复杂性。 不适合所有情况对于某些特定的应用程序响应式设计可能不是最佳选择因为它可能无法提供所需的用户体验。 测试难度测试响应式设计需要在多个设备和浏览器上进行测试这可能会增加测试的复杂性。 潜在兼容性问题在一些旧版本的浏览器中响应式设计可能存在兼容性问题需要额外的代码来解决。
http://www.yutouwan.com/news/313207/

相关文章:

  • 天河外贸型网站建设网站第二次备案
  • 德阳有哪些做网站的公司手机登录凡科网
  • 网站建设倒计时单页源码网站建设找导师蓝林
  • 色流网站怎么做网站建设与管理就业岗位 方向
  • 徐汇网站制作东营公共资源交易网
  • 一哥优购物官方网站做ps的网站有哪些功能吗
  • 西宁网站建设费用网站中全景是怎么做的
  • 建设局网站投诉开发商wordpress 样式
  • 奉贤网站建设推广wordpress 地址 固定
  • 做非法网站怎么盈利网络安全行业公司排名
  • 网站开发一般要多少钱广州最新新闻事件今天
  • 旅游网站建设有哪些不足云服务器 部署网站
  • 做产地证新网站青县网站建设咨询
  • 白之家低成本做网站镇江新区
  • 做网站致富南京市住房和城乡建设网站
  • 漳州网站建设点击博大选自己做的网站如何上首页
  • 淮安专业网站建设vps服务器怎么做网站
  • 哪些网站可以做淘宝店招做视频上传可以赚钱的网站
  • 安徽省建设工程造价管理总站网站做app网站制作
  • 专业商城网站设计制作在线建筑设计
  • 可信网站认证有用吗wordpress sql注入
  • 商场网站开发教程网站排名优化服务商
  • 怎么建设国际网站首页中国苏州网
  • 哪个网站可以做危险化学品供求网站打开速度慢优化
  • 开发网站找什么公司吗代理网络服务器
  • 昆明网站设计阿里邮箱 wordpress
  • 网站彩票代理怎么做做外贸在哪个平台比较好
  • 嘉兴建设公司网站网络投票程序
  • 站长之家网站建设制作pc端网站建设哪里有
  • 学校门户网站建设方案重庆活动轨迹公布